RFA/RFC: vCont for the remote protocol [doco]


Documentation, as promised.  Reserves the `v' letter for multi-letter
packets.

+@item @code{v} --- verbose packet prefix
 
-Reserved for future use.
+Packets starting with @code{v} are identified by a multi-letter name,
+up to the first @code{:} if any.
+
+@item @code{vCont:}[@var{action}@code{:}@var{tid}@code{;}]...[@var{action}] --- extended resume
+@cindex @code{vCont} packet
+
+Resume the inferior.  Different actions may be specified for each thread.
+If a final action is specified, then it is applied to all threads not
+explicitly mentioned; if no final action is specified, all other threads
+should remain stopped.  Possible actions are @code{s}, @code{S}@var{sig},
+@code{c}, and @code{C}@var{sig}, with the same meanings as those packets.
+The final @var{addr} associated with those packets is not supported in
+@code{vCont}.  Thread IDs are specified in hexadecimal.
+
+First reply:
+@table @samp
+@item OK
+for success
+@item E@var{NN}
+for an error
+@end table
+
+If the first reply is @samp{OK}, then the inferior will be resumed, and
+another reply sent when it stops.  @xref{Stop Reply Packets}, for the reply
+specifications.
